99 /* Exact match cache for frequently used flows
101 * The cache uses a 32-bit hash of the packet (which can be the RSS hash) to
102 * search its entries for a miniflow that matches exactly the miniflow of the
103 * packet. It stores the 'dpcls_rule' (rule) that matches the miniflow.
105 * A cache entry holds a reference to its 'dp_netdev_flow'.
107 * A miniflow with a given hash can be in one of EM_FLOW_HASH_SEGS different
108 * entries. The 32-bit hash is split into EM_FLOW_HASH_SEGS values (each of
109 * them is EM_FLOW_HASH_SHIFT bits wide and the remainder is thrown away). Each
110 * value is the index of a cache entry where the miniflow could be.
116 * Each pmd_thread has its own private exact match cache.
117 * If dp_netdev_input is not called from a pmd thread, a mutex is used.

363 /* PMD: Poll modes drivers. PMD accesses devices via polling to eliminate
364 * the performance overhead of interrupt processing. Therefore netdev can
365 * not implement rx-wait for these devices. dpif-netdev needs to poll
366 * these device to check for recv buffer. pmd-thread does polling for
367 * devices assigned to itself.
369 * DPDK used PMD for accessing NIC.
371 * Note, instance with cpu core id NON_PMD_CORE_ID will be reserved for
372 * I/O of all non-pmd threads. There will be no actual thread created
375 * Each struct has its own flow table and classifier. Packets received
376 * from managed ports are looked up in the corresponding pmd thread's
377 * flow table, and are executed with the found actions.
